JNNURM in Punjab

for Ministry of Urban Development | Date - 28-01-2010


A total of 6 projects have been sanctioned for the two Mission cities viz. Amritsar and Ludhiana in the State of Punjab under Urban Infrastructure & Governance (UIG) of Jawaharlal Nehru National Urban Renewal Mission(JNNURM) for an approved cost of Rs.725.39 crore. The Additional Central Assistance (ACA) committed for the projects are Rs.362.70 crore. An amount of Rs. 146.73 crore has been released to the state as ACA so far.

Under Urban Infrastructure Development Scheme for Small and Medium Towns (UIDSSMT) of JNNURM, 17 projects for 14 cities of Punjab (Jalandhar, Bathinda, Malout, Majitha, Pathankot, Zirakpur, Adampur, FatehgarhChurrai, Ferozpur, Kapurthala, Patiala, Sunam, Talwandisabo and Muktasar) have been sanctioned for an approved cost of Rs.395.77 crore with ACA commitment of Rs.316.62 crore. An amount of Rs. 159.54 crore has been released as ACA so far.

State of Punjab has exhausted the seven year allocation under UIDSSMT. Punjab has a balance of Rs.268 cr. from overall allocation under UIG. JNNURM is a demand driven programme under which Projects in conformity with the guidelines and emanating from the City Development Plan (CDP) and submitted by the State as per the prioritization are eligible for funding subject to their technical appraisal and availability of funds.
